Can you rely on it? fairness, protection, and peace of mind

Trust matters most when real money is involved, and software providers play a bigger role than many players realize. While casinos handle payments and account security, the provider is responsible for how games behave: RNG (random number generation), return-to-player settings where applicable, and the overall integrity of gameplay.

In plain terms: reputable providers build games that can be tested and audited, so outcomes aren’t “steered” by the casino on the fly. Look for licensing and independent testing information on your chosen casino’s game details or footer—serious operators will display it. When a casino carries a major provider’s catalog, it’s typically because that provider can meet compliance and technical standards across multiple jurisdictions.

Smooth on your phone: why the mobile experience feels dialed in

Mobile play is where great games separate themselves from “good enough” ones. Pragmatic Play titles are generally designed with mobile-first performance in mind: interfaces scale cleanly, buttons are easy to hit, and features don’t become a tiny maze on smaller screens.

For players, that translates into fewer annoyances—less lag during bonus rounds, fewer misclicks, and quicker loading even when you’re not on perfect Wi‑Fi. It also means you can bounce between games without the casino lobby feeling like it’s dragging a heavy suitcase behind you.

The hidden force behind your gameplay: why software matters

Casino software isn’t just a logo in the lobby—it shapes almost everything you experience. It affects how quickly games load, how stable bonus rounds feel, how clear the rules are, and whether the overall presentation builds confidence or raises doubts.

Good software also means fewer “weird moments” that break immersion: freezing during a feature, confusing paytables, or sluggish interfaces that make you second-guess what just happened.
